Metallarmband für den Garmin Forerunner 165

Das speziell für den Garmin Forerunner 165 entwickelte Bandz Metallarmband verleiht deiner Uhr einen einzigartigen und stilvollen Look. Das Zinklegierungs-Material überzeugt durch hochwertige Verarbeitung und robuste Qualität. Das Garmin Forerunner 165 Metallarmband hat eine spezielle Schließe, mit der du es sicher befestigen kannst. Die Glieder dieses Uhrenarmbandes können mit dem mitgelieferten Verkürzungsset auf die Handgelenksgröße gekürzt werden.

Perfekt für formelle und legere Anlässe

Dieses Metallarmband ist aufgrund seiner Eigenschaften für viele Arten von Anlässen geeignet. Mit seinem stilvollen Aussehen kannst du dieses Armband problemlos zur Arbeit, aber natürlich auch bei einem Tagesausflug tragen. Mit diesem Metallband beeindruckst du überall.

Langlebig

Die Qualität von Bandz sorgt dafür, dass du dieses Band eine ganze Weile tragen kannst. So hast du lange Zeit Freude an deinem neuen Armband.
